While nobody is sure how, it's a generally accepted scientific fact that plants do indeed perceive sound. They respond to, for example, wind frequency, insect buzzing vs insect chewing noises, and also the sounds made by other plants, which vary according to the activity of water transmission along the xylem. Attaching mics to plants, you get ultrasonic sound when there's more water, and audible sound when there's less (which makes bubbles).

Most marine photosynthesizers, including the deceptively plant-looking Giant Kelp, are seaweed, ie algae, and therefore not plants; p much the only exception is the various species of "seagrass". Seagrass has an evolutionary path like that of marine mammals (but way before them); started, as all plants did, as algae, adapted to grow on land for a couple hundred millennia, and then went back to the sea.
